A stress fracture is a small crack in a bone that develops from repetitive force rather than a single injury. It commonly occurs in the feet and ankles due to repeated stress from activities such as walking and running. Causes include sudden increases in running speed or distance, and inadequate...

Morton’s neuroma is a painful condition involving thickened tissue around a nerve in the forefoot, often between the third and fourth toes. It is commonly seen in individuals who exercise frequently, especially with activities that involve repetitive pressure on the ball of the foot. Risk factors...
